Look for a Warm, Supportive Pastoral Environment

Children learn best when they feel safe, valued, and happy. When visiting potential schools, pay close attention to the atmosphere in the corridors and classrooms.

What to ask: How does the school support children’s mental health and emotional well-being? Are small class sizes used to ensure individual attention?

A Broad and Inspiring Curriculum

Does the school follow the Common Entrance curriculum, or do they offer a broader, bespoke programme? Is their focus on traditional subjects or a more modern, interdisciplinary approach?
A great prep school education balances core academic subjects with creative arts, sports, science, and outdoor learning. Look for a curriculum that encourages curiosity and critical thinking rather than just exam preparation.

Learning Support

What resources are available for pupils who require extra support, or for those who are highly able and need more challenging material?

Pastoral Care and Ethos

What is the school’s policy on pastoral care, mental health, and student well-being? A strong system ensures your child feels supported during the transition years.

Do the school’s core values (e.g., resilience, kindness, curiosity) align with your family’s values? This connection is crucial for a happy school life.

The School Environment

Would your child flourish in a smaller, more intimate school setting or a larger school with more resources and a wider range of sports and clubs?

Co-curricular Activities

Look beyond the classroom. What opportunities exist in sport, music, drama, and outdoor education? These areas often define the Prep School experience and provide crucial development opportunities.
